Focus on Capabilities, Not Structure Compliance
OpenTelemetry is an evolving specification, one where the desires and use cases are clear, but the method to satisfy those uses cases are not.
As such, Contributions should provide functionality and behavior that conforms to the specification, but the interface and structure are flexible.
It is preferable to have contributions follow the idioms of the language rather than conform to specific API names or argument patterns in the spec.

Linting
SwiftLint
The SwiftLint Xcode plugin can be optionally enabled during development by using an environmental variable when opening the project from the commandline.
OTEL_ENABLE_SWIFTLINT=1 open Package.swift
Note: Xcode must be completely closed before running the above command, close Xcode using ⌘Q or running killall xcode in the commandline.
SwiftFormat
SwiftFormat is also used to enforce formatting rules where Swiftlint isn't able.
It will also run in the optionally enabled pre-commit hook if installed via brew install swiftformat.

Generating OTLP protobuf files
Occasionally, the opentelemetry protocol's protobuf definitions are updated and need to be regenerated for the OTLP exporters. This is documentation on how to accomplish that for this project. Other projects can regenerate their otlp protobuf files using the Open Telemetry build tools.
Requirements
Install protoc
$ brew install protobuf
$ protoc --version # Ensure compiler version is 3+
Installing grpc-swift
brew install swift-protobuf grpc-swift
Generating otlp protobuf files
Clone opentelemetry-proto
From within opentelemetry-proto:
# collect the proto definitions:
PROTO_FILES=($(ls opentelemetry/proto/*/*/*/*.proto opentelemetry/proto/*/*/*.proto))
# generate swift proto files
for file in "${PROTO_FILES[@]}"
do
protoc --swift_opt=Visibility=Public --swift_out=./out ${file}
done
# genearate GRPC swift proto files
protoc --swift_opt=Visibility=Public --grpc-swift_opt=Visibility=Public --swift_out=./out --grpc-swift_out=./out opentelemetry/proto/collector/trace/v1/trace_service.proto
protoc --swift_opt=Visibility=Public --grpc-swift_opt=Visibility=Public --swift_out=./out --grpc-swift_out=./out opentelemetry/proto/collector/metrics/v1/metrics_service.proto
protoc --swift_opt=Visibility=Public --grpc-swift_opt=Visibility=Public --swift_out=./out --grpc-swift_out=./out opentelemetry/proto/collector/logs/v1/logs_service.proto
Replace the generated files in Sources/Exporters/OpenTelemetryProtocolCommon/proto & Sources/Exporters/OpenTelemetryGrpc/proto:
OpenTelemetryProtocolGrpc/proto file list
logs_service.grpc.swift
metrics_serivce.grpc.swift
trace_service.grpc.swift
OpenTelemetryProtocolCommon/proto
common.pb.swift
logs.pb.swift
logs_service.pb.swift
metrics.pb.swift
metrics_services.pb.swift
resource.pb.swift
trace.pb.swift
trace_service.pb.swift
